Clinical Nutrition for Migraine & Headache Management

Led by Dr. Howard Benedikt, this course offers a comprehensive look at the nutritional management of headaches. Practitioners will explore the incidence of various headache types, identify environmental and dietary triggers, and learn to implement natural remedies—ranging from Magnesium and CoQ10 to targeted herbal interventions like Curcumin.

Course Topics

  • Headache Classification: Analyzing Tension, Migraine, Cluster, Sinus, and Hormone-related headaches.
  • Trigger Identification: Understanding environmental catalysts, hormonal shifts, and specific food sensitivities.
  • Natural Remediation: Clinical use of Vitamin D, Magnesium (Mg), Fish Oil, and CoQ10.
  • Detoxification & Sleep: The role of metabolic detox and Melatonin in headache frequency reduction.
  • Herbal Support: Evaluating the therapeutic potential of Curcumin and Saw Palmetto.
